HomePhabricator

Various fixes and additions to creduce-clang-crash.py

Description

Various fixes and additions to creduce-clang-crash.py

Some more additions to the script - mainly reducing the clang args after
the creduce run by removing them one by one and seeing if the crash
reproduces. Other things:

  • remove the --crash flag when "fatal error" occurs
  • fixed to read stack trace functions from the top
  • run creduce on a copy of the original file

Patch by Amy Huang!

Differential Revision: https://reviews.llvm.org/D59725

Details

Committed
gbivMar 29 2019, 10:50 AM
Differential Revision
D59725: Additions to creduce script
Parents
rL357289: [AMDGPU] Add an additional Code Object V3 assembler example
Branches
Unknown
Tags
Unknown